AFL great hits back after Riewoldt’s ’Supreme Court’ grand final concussion call

Essendon great Matthew Lloyd has strongly disagreed with Nick Riewoldts statement on concussion leading into Grand Finals.
While stressing the importance of concussion and current AFL guidelines, Riewoldt explained he would do everything in his power even going to the Supreme Court to play in a Grand Final if he felt fit, even if he was to be ruled ineligible under the mandatory 12-day stand down period after head knocks.
